Polycarbophil

Polycarbophil can be used as an excipient, such as ointment base, release blocker, thickener, emulsifier. Pharmaceutical excipients, or pharmaceutical auxiliaries, refer to other chemical substances used in the pharmaceutical process other than pharmaceutical ingredients. Pharmaceutical excipients generally refer to inactive ingredients in pharmaceutical preparations, which can improve the stability, solubility and processability of pharmaceutical preparations. Pharmaceutical excipients also affect the absorption, distribution, metabolism, and elimination (ADME) processes of co-administered drugs[1].

3-TYP

3-TYP is a selective SIRT3 inhibitor, with an IC50 of 16 nM, more potent over SIRT1 (IC50=88 nM), SIRT2 (IC50=92 nM).

Quinacrine mustard dihydrochloride

Quinacrine mustard dihydrochloride is a fluorochrome. Quinacrine mustard dihydrochloride as a polycyclic aromatic agent can be used as mutagenic agent induces the mutants of bacteria. Quinacrine mustard dihydrochloride induces cell cycle arrest at G2/M-phase. Quinacrine mustard dihydrochloride has the potential for the research of plant, animal, or human chromosomes[1][2][3].

Neobavaisoflavone

Neobavaisoflavone, an isoflavone isolated from Psoralea corylifolia, has striking anti-inflammatory and anti-cancer effects. IC50 value: 42.93 μM (toward CCRF-CEM cells); 114.64 μM [against HCT116 (p53(+/+)) cells] [2]Target:In vitro: In the cancer cells, neobavaisoflavone sensitizes human U373MG glioma cells to TRAIL-mediated apoptosis; upregulated DR5 expression; induced TRAIL-mediated apoptosis in human glioma cells by suppressing migration and invasion, and by inhibiting anoikis resistance [1]. In caner cell lines, neobavaisoflavone is selectively active, and IC50 values below 115 μM were obtained on 6/9 cell lines, with values ranging from 42.93 μM (toward CCRF-CEM cells) to 114.64 μM [against HCT116 (p53(+/+)) cells] [2].
